Do you still get attacked by pirates if you have limpets in inventory?

I always found this system dumb, i want to get a collector limpet to pickup stuff fast for engineer materials. Do pirates still attack if limpets are in your inventory just because they seem like cargo to them?
 
You can still have pirates attack you without cargo.

When you drop into a ring, there will be a pirate spawn. These pirates will scan you and leave if you have nothing except limpets. But if you have any mining missions, sometimes a pirate will follow you from supercruise. These pirates may still attack even if they have scanned you and found no cargo.
 
Yes, the pirates that spawn in normal space (eg at beacons, RES) won't attack you if they scan you and find only limpets. But the pirates in Supercruise will still babble about you having "tasty cargo" and interdict you or, as LL said, they'll follow your wake if you drop down before they interdict you. Of course, they'll still do all that even if you have nothing at all in the hold and are only "carrying" exploration data or mission tickets, so it isn't really a "limpet problem".
